Designed with both precision and modularity in mind the MRAD is equally at home on the range or on duty.

A new addition to the award-winning MRAD product line the Single Mission Rifle (SMR).
The new MRAD SMR features the same performance of the regular MRAD along with .75 MOA accuracy but in a simplified package utilizing 90% parts commonality with the standard MRAD configuration.

The Single Mission Rifle name comes from the fact that the rifle is set from the factory in only one caliber unlike the interchangeable barrel ability of the standard MRAD. The primary distinction of the SMR is the free float barrel which is held in the upper receiver with a standard barrel nut. Additionally the non-folding stock is fixed with a vertically adjustable cheek piece and separate spacers for length of pull adjustment. These changes lead to a slimmer lighter overall rifle; trimming nearly 2 ½ lbs. off the weight and 1 inch off the overall length of the standard MRAD rifle.
